58384 Zip Code Historical Race Data
ACS 2010-2014 data
Total population: 564
White: | 540 (95.74%, see rank) | Black: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Hispanic: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Asian: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Native (American Indian, Alaska Native, Hawaiian Native, etc.): | 20 (3.55%, see rank) | One Race, Other: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Two or More Races: | 4 (0.71%, see rank) |

US Census 2010 data
Total population: 549
White: | 526 (95.81%, see rank) | Black: | 6 (1.09%, see rank) | Hispanic: | 4 (0.73%, see rank) | Asian: | 1 (0.18%, see rank) | Native (American Indian, Alaska Native, Hawaiian Native, etc.): | 9 (1.64%, see rank) | One Race, Other: | 1 (0.18%, see rank) | Two or More Races: | 6 (1.09%, see rank) |

ACS 2008-2012 data
Total population: 529
White: | 507 (95.84%, see rank) | Black: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Hispanic: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Asian: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Native (American Indian, Alaska Native, Hawaiian Native, etc.): | 22 (4.16%, see rank) | One Race, Other: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Two or More Races: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) |

US Census 2000 data
Total population: 756
White: | 735 (97.22%, see rank) | Black: | 2 (0.26%, see rank) | Hispanic: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Asian: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Native (American Indian, Alaska Native, Hawaiian Native, etc.): | 9 (1.19%, see rank) | One Race, Other: | 0 (0.00%, see rank) | Two or More Races: | 10 (1.32%, see rank) |
